What is the difference between Senior Optical Engineer vs Optical Engineer?

AspectSenior Optical EngineerOptical Engineer
Required CredentialsBachelor's or Master's in Optical Engineering, Physics, or related field; 5+ years experienceBachelor's or Master's in Optical Engineering, Physics, or related field; 1-3 years experience
Work EnvironmentResearch labs, manufacturing, R&D departmentsDesign, testing, and development in labs or production settings
Employer & Industry UsageTech companies, aerospace, defense, medical devicesOptical product companies, research institutions, manufacturing

Senior Optical Engineers typically have more experience and responsibilities, including leading projects and mentoring. Optical Engineers focus on designing and testing optical systems. Both roles require similar educational backgrounds but differ in experience level and scope of work.

What does a senior optical engineer do?

A Senior Optical Engineer is responsible for designing, developing, and testing optical systems and components, such as lenses, lasers, and imaging devices. They often work on projects involving fiber optics, sensors, and advanced photonics technologies. Senior Optical Engineers lead technical teams, troubleshoot complex optical issues, and collaborate with other engineers to integrate optical solutions into larger systems. Their expertise is essential in industries like telecommunications, medical devices, aerospace, and consumer electronics.

What are the key skills and qualifications needed to thrive as a senior optical engineer?

To thrive as a Senior Optical Engineer, you need advanced knowledge of optics, physics, and optical system design, typically supported by a degree in optical engineering or a related field and several years of industry experience. Expertise with optical design software (such as Zemax or Code V), CAD tools, and familiarity with relevant standards and certifications are commonly required. Strong problem-solving abilities, attention to detail, and effective communication set top candidates apart, especially when leading teams or interfacing with clients. These skills ensure the development of innovative, precise optical solutions that meet technical and business objectives.

Instrumentation & Controls Discipline Lead

Overview

Hargrove Engineers & Constructors is seeking a highly experienced Instrumentation & Controls (I&C) Discipline Lead to provide technical leadership for industrial capital projects and control system modernization initiatives, including large-scale DCS migration programs. This role is responsible for leading I&C engineering teams, driving project execution, ensuring technical excellence, and delivering high-quality engineering solutions throughout all phases of a project lifecycle.

The ideal candidate is a proven I&C leader with a strong background in instrumentation design, control system hardware, and project execution. This individual will lead multidisciplinary teams, oversee engineering deliverables, mentor technical staff, and serve as a trusted advisor to clients and project stakeholders. While familiarity with control systems is essential, this position focuses on instrumentation engineering and control system hardware implementation rather than software programming or DCS configuration.
